Great Ways For Classic VW Parts

 

One of the greatest challenges of owning a classic car is to find sourcing replacement parts at a decent price. To help you figure out, we have highlighted the best ways to find the resources for your Classic VW parts.

Driving a contemporary car and finding the replacement part is as easy as going to a grocery store and buying the stuff. They are easily available but with the classic vintage cars, it takes time. Also, the parts are expensive and take time to get delivered. But, don’t worry from the below-mentioned sources you will quickly find ways to get back on track with your classic cars.



The car website

If your classic car is a VW, you may be able to get what you need right from the Volkswagen website or their authorized dealer’s website selling the parts.

You may need to do some research when looking for the part on the website. Ideally, the website will have menus like “Classic Parts” or “ Licensed Restoration Parts.

Brick and mortar stores

Believe it or not but it's true. These places still exist where you can physically walk into the spare part store and leave with the part in your hands.

The beauty of these brick and mortar stores is able to talk to the experts about what kind of Classic VW parts you need and which one will be the best. Call ahead with your make, and model, and year to ensure that they have the part with them.

Classic car database

As the name implies, the Classic Car Database is the most wide-ranging website useful for antique car lovers. Ideal for finding replacement Classic VW parts, as well as Vintage cars chances are you’ll find something useful on this site. The Classic Cars Database serves as a directory of vendors, services, and parts, all aimed at the classic car enthusiast.
